Publisher's Synopsis

Powerful stories about the way sports can bring together fathers and sons, to work out their differences and express their love for each other.

Fathers & Sons & Sports
presents a powerful lineup of real-world stories about fathers and sons playing one-on-one in the game of life, written by such great sportswriters and authors as

Henry Aaron, as told to Cal Fussman  Michael J. Agovino  Buzz Bissinger  Jeff Bradley  John Ed Bradley  James Brown  Darcy Frey  Tom Friend  Bill Geist  Mike Golic  Donald Hall  Paul Hoffman  Mark Kriegel  Norman Maclean  John Buffalo Mailer  Ron Reagan  Peter Richmond  Jeremy Schaap  Lew Schneider  Dan Shaughnessy  Paul Solotaroff  John Jeremiah Sullivan  Wright Thompson  Steve Wulf

The unforgettable accounts here include the stories of a professional football player passing on his father' s secrets to his own sons, a severely disabled boy discovering joy on a surfboard, a wealthy NFL player taking his coddled children back to the mean streets that made him, and a major league manager who must face the hard fact that nothing, not even unconditional love, can save his son.

Anyone who has ever been a father or a son will see himself in these moving snapshots of family life at its most emotional. Whether the stories take place on a diamond, a court, a gridiron, a fairway, or a chessboard, they're all about the same subject: fatherhood, one of the world's most intriguing sports.
